Chapter 61

He went to look for Amelie? S-So he heard everything I said to her?

Laura felt her mind go blank. Her legs buckled and she almost fell, but she managed to hold onto the wall just in time.

“Leo!” A silvery voice sounded.

Amelie! Laura stared at her boss and Amelie, but they didn’t run into each other. Instead, Amelie was getting further away.

The next moment, Elyse showed up. A smile curled her lips, and her gaze was filled with love-love for Leo. She approached him and held his arm tightly. Oh, so it was just Elyse. The boss almost ran into Amelie, but he

missed her.

A sigh of relief escaped her lips. Look at me, getting scared out of my wits.

“Why did you bring me here, Leo?” asked Elyse quietly. She remained smiling, though there was confusion in her eyes.

Leo patted the back of her hand. “Just a checkup, that’s all.”

“I just did a full-body checkup, though.” She put on her best elegant smile.

“One more time for good measure.” Leo stared into Elyse’s eyes.

He had made an appointment for a checkup of her eyes. The doctor told him the donor was a girl named Amelie, but the doctor in Quinn Town told him the one who consulted him about living donation was someone called Elyse. He only knew one Elyse, and that was Elyse Clayton. She was the one who donated her cornea to him. Leo chalked the inconsistency between the doctors’ testimonials as a slip of the tongue. Measure twice and cut once, though.

Elyse touched her eyes, which were her most beautiful trait. They glistened and gleamed all the time. When she met Leo’s eyes-ones that were also filled with love-she would put on a timid, sheepish smile.

Leo took that smile in another way. He thought she wouldn’t want him to find out she donated her cornea to him. That was why he didn’t tell her he wanted to verify that the donor was her. “You should go in now,” he muttered.

Laura watched as her boss took Elyse away. She was still confused about the whole situation. She didn’t hear the conversation Leo had with the doctor, so she had no idea that they talked about the donor, and now, Leo was taking Elyse to the ophthalmologist’s room.

However, she did know that Elyse’s sight was almost perfect. Is he trying to find out who the donor is? Dammit. Laura stood around and waited until Elyse had gone into the room alone, then she called her.

“Yes, Laura? If it’s alright with you, can this wait?” asked Elyse softly.

Standing before her were tons of machines that were built to check one’s eyesight. The ophthalmologist was already waiting for her. The old Elyse would have flown into a rage just from this call, but now she had to make herself out to be a polite and mature woman, so she spoke softly.

“Don’t hang up!” said Laura quickly. “This is important!”

Oh, is it? Elyse covered the microphone on her phone and apologized to the ophthalmologist, “Sorry, doctor, but can I take this call?”

“Elyse, a white lie won’t kill anyone. Certainly not a relationship. In fact, it’d help you guys,” Laura persuaded patiently.

Laura liked Leo as well, but Elyse was leagues better in the looks department alone, let alone everything else. She envied the fact that Elyse was a celebrity. Dating a celebrity would be better than dating an assistant, or that was what she thought. She knew she wouldn’t be worthy of Leo, so Laura expressed her love in another way-by helping Elyse get Leo.” Just…” Laura took a deep breath. “Just do as I say. Make him think you’re the donor.”

“But this is insane!”

Not even the old Elyse would do that, and she was properly crazy back then.

Laura gripped her phone tightly. “Elyse, listen to me. That girl donated her cornea without asking for anything in return. If Mr. Alston finds her, he will return the favor. And think about it. Why did the girl donate her cornea willingly?”

“Um…” Elyse gripped her phone tightly as a sense of crisis overwhelmed her. She was clear about the implications. There was only one reason for that girl to donate a part of her willingly. Love. I used to be young once I know how far crazy people can go. She opened her mouth, but her chest suddenly felt heavy. It stopped her from saying anything.

Laura continued, “You finally got back with Mr. Alston after going through so much. There’s no need to cause more problems. Just make him think you’re the donor, and he’ll stop the search for that girl. Then, you can move on to the next stage of your relationship. You said you’re taking this seriously, so make him forget the past. Take his attention completely Bring back the good old days.”

Oh, that was Elyse’s dream.

Laura struck a nerve, which left Elyse feeling that Leo wasn’t treating her as he used to, and she had been

trying to make him look at her once more. Should I do it? She clenched her fists so hard that her nails dug into her flesh and her knuckles turned white, and finally, she steeled her resolve.
